When writing young adult novels, it is important to establish interesting and appealing protagonists. All the bestselling YA books have unforgettable and legendary protagonists, which is exactly why it is so crucial to craft characters that readers are going to have an interest in. Much like with adult fiction, these characters ought to be multilayered and three-dimensional, which implies that they need to have imperfections, weaknesses and insecurities. They need their own background stories, relationships and character growth during the course of the plot. Authors should not focus on producing perfect and flawless characters, as this is not relatable to the readers. The main distinction between the protagonist in a YA novel compared to an adult novel is the age range. The YA lead character should preferably reflect the age range of the target markets, as it is essential for them to see themselves in the main characters.

When looking at the dos and don'ts of writing a YA novel, one of the most significant don'ts is to overuse teen slang and terminology. One of the most significant pitfalls of YA authors is trying too hard to sound young. Whilst it is important to stay up to date with the latest trends within the age demographic, it is just as crucial to remember that a lot of youngsters actually talk like grownups. Another one of the most crucial tips for writing young adult fiction is to not be patronising or condescending to the readers. Aim to entertain, not educate and raise questions rather than answering them. Also avoid being flippant or dismissive of teen problems that may appear very minor to you.
As an aspiring author, among the most successful, prominent and in-demand book markets is young adult fiction. So, what is young adult fiction? Essentially, young adult fiction is specified as novels which are written specifically for 13-17 year old bookworms. It's not a particular genre, however rather an age range and a general category. For those wanting to know how to write a book for young adults, the initial step is grasping what the general guidelines are. For instance, one of the main guidelines for writing young adult fiction is to keep the content non-explicit. This does not imply that authors need to shy away from deep topics completely; numerous young adult books look into a series of vital subject matters but approach it in a a lot more sensitive way in comparison to adult fiction.
